Our team of licensed mental health professionals, therapists, and trauma specialists is skilled in addressing a wide range of emotional and psychological concerns, including:
Severe accidents can leave patients dealing with flashbacks, heightened anxiety, or other symptoms of trauma. Using evidence-based techniques like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R), we help individuals process their experiences and reduce trauma-related stress.
Chronic pain often creates a cycle of physical and emotional suffering. We offer counseling that addresses the connection between pain and emotional well-being, helping patients manage their symptoms more effectively.
Traumatic events may lead to the devastating loss of loved ones, resulting in grief and depression. Our grief counseling services provide a supportive environment for patients to explore and process their emotions, fostering healing and resilience.
Adjusting to a permanent injury or disability can result in anxiety, depression, and feelings of hopelessness. Our clinicians prioritize offering patients coping tools and emotional support to help them manage their new circumstances and discover ways to continue living their lives as they did before the event.
We understand that traumatic brain injuries affect more than just physical health, often impacting emotions, cognition, and daily life. Our team provides personalized, evidence-based care to address these challenges, helping clients recover and regain control with confidence.
Our team will help individuals regain essential daily living skills through personalized support and practical strategies. From personal care to household tasks, our goal is to restore independence and improve quality of life with compassionate guidance every step of the way.
